In February, we will begin a six-part workshop series that will be a significant step in the continued alignment and growth of OUR Safety. Named FOCUS (Forming One Common Understanding Of Safety), this workshop series will provide the platform necessary to establish a common understanding of OUR Safety programs. The initial audience for the FOCUS workshops are those associates who oversee the performance and work of others.
Each FOCUS workshop will be between 45 and 50 minutes in length. They will be conducted in February, April, June, August, September, and November. FOCUS workshops will be hosted in the OPS Technician Training facility for Louisville participants and will be broadcast as webinars for associates outside of Louisville.
In order to maximize participation, each FOCUS workshop will be offered on six occasions: three consecutive Mondays from 9 am - 10 am EST and three consecutive Fridays from 2 pm - 3 pm EST.
